Amazon ec2 如何从Docker Hub private repo在EC2 ECS上部署Docker容器?

Amazon ec2 如何从Docker Hub private repo在EC2 ECS上部署Docker容器?,amazon-ec2,docker,dockerhub,Amazon Ec2,Docker,Dockerhub,我在一个私有Docker Hub存储库中有一个映像,我正试图将其部署到Amazon的弹性容器服务上。似乎有很好的web控制台可以从公共存储库运行容器,但对于私有存储库却没有。我已经阅读并试图理解,但我不明白这与部署我的容器有什么关系,因为它声明“Amazon ECS容器代理允许容器实例连接到您的集群” 作为使用web控制台的替代方案,我看到了关于设置任务定义的提及。这听起来像是web控制台的手动版本。我想我的最佳选择是使用这种方法,可能是借助于这里的脚本 对我来说,在托管在私有存储库中的ECS上

我在一个私有Docker Hub存储库中有一个映像,我正试图将其部署到Amazon的弹性容器服务上。似乎有很好的web控制台可以从公共存储库运行容器,但对于私有存储库却没有。我已经阅读并试图理解,但我不明白这与部署我的容器有什么关系,因为它声明“Amazon ECS容器代理允许容器实例连接到您的集群”

作为使用web控制台的替代方案,我看到了关于设置任务定义的提及。这听起来像是web控制台的手动版本。我想我的最佳选择是使用这种方法,可能是借助于这里的脚本


对我来说,在托管在私有存储库中的ECS上运行现有映像的最简单方法是什么?

没错,因此容器实例就是碰巧运行集群中定义的服务的EC2机器。然后,集群可以作为容器实例连接到EC2机器,但除非EC2机器进行了适当配置,否则它无法运行您的私有存储库。

对于其他尝试在amazon上进行简单容器部署的人:我最终部署到elastic beanstalk。它非常简单,运行良好,并且能够自我维护。